Understanding the Sales Purchase Report
Before we jump into the “how,” let’s talk about the “what.”
A Sales Purchase Report is a summary of all the transactions your business has made — both incoming (purchases) and outgoing (sales).
It includes:
Invoice numbers and dates
GSTIN of your suppliers and buyers
Taxable amounts and GST collected
Type of supply (intra-state or inter-state)
When you download the Sales Purchase Reports Data download of Particular GST, you get all this information neatly packed in one file.
This helps you save time, avoid errors, and stay compliant.

Step-by-Step: Sales Purchase Report Data Download of Particular GST
Let’s walk through the process again, but in detail.
Step 1: Log In
Visit the official GST portal. Use your GSTIN and password to log in.
Step 2: Go to Returns Dashboard
Once inside, click on the ‘Returns Dashboard’ option.
Step 3: Choose the Period
Select the Financial Year and Month or Quarter you want to see.
Step 4: Select the Type of Data
Choose between Sales (Outward Supplies) and Purchase (Inward Supplies).
Step 5: Download the Report
Click on the Download button. You’ll get an Excel or JSON file that shows all your transactions linked to that particular GST number.
Now you have your Sales Purchase Reports Data of Particular GST ready for review.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Downloading GST Data
Even though the process is simple, small mistakes can create big problems. Here are a few things to watch out for:
Don’t select the wrong GSTIN — if your business has multiple ones, double-check.
Always choose the correct return period.
Save the file in a safe folder — you’ll need it during filing.
Avoid editing the file manually before verifying it.
These small steps help keep your records clean and your GST filing smooth.
Tips to Handle Multiple GSTINs
If your business operates in different states, you may have more than one GST number. In that case, repeat the Sales Purchase Report Data Download process for each GSTIN separately.
To make it easy:
Create separate folders for each GST number.
Rename files with the month and year for quick access.
Use spreadsheet filters to analyze sales and purchases side by side.
This way, your GST data stays organized and easy to understand.
